> Although actually, you can't capture stderr in a variable like this at
> all.  freopen() at a later point will close the current FILE object and
> create a new one, after which this logger will use-after-free.

freopen(...,f) always returns NULL or f.  There's no way to change the
pointer value of stderr.  Indeed some libcs have
  #define stderr (&__stdiostreams[2])
or some such.
